Vancouver at a Glance
Vancouver, WA Apartments for Rent
Founded in 1825 around Fort Vancouver, a historic fur trading outpost, Vancouver stretches along the north bank of the Columbia River as Washington's fourth-largest city with nearly 200,000 residents. If you're searching for apartments for rent in Vancouver, you'll discover a market with average rents of $1,519 for one-bedroom units and $1,704 for two-bedroom apartments, with rental prices holding steady over the past year. The city pairs small-town warmth with contemporary conveniences, featuring a revitalized downtown centered around Esther Short Park and the growing Vancouver Waterfront district.
Renting in Vancouver gives you the best of both worldsâoutdoor adventures along the Columbia River and quick access to Portland's jobs and entertainment just 20-30 minutes south. Popular neighborhoods include tree-lined Hough, Fisher's Landing with its variety of housing choices, and the downtown Arts District anchored by the restored Kiggins Theatre. Getting around is easy with C-TRAN public transportation offering express service to Portland, plus you'll enjoy local perks like Washington State University Vancouver, the Columbia River Waterfront Renaissance Trail, and convenient shopping at Westfield Vancouver mall. The city's location connects you to major highways while maintaining a more relaxed atmosphere than bustling Portland.
Renting in Vancouver
Average Rental Rates and Apartment Sizes
- Apartment Type Average Sq Ft Average Rent
- Studio 497 Sq Ft $1,385 / mo
- 1 Bedroom 704 Sq Ft $1,538 / mo
- 2 Bedrooms 979 Sq Ft $1,721 / mo
- 3 Bedrooms 1,250 Sq Ft $2,127 / mo
- 4 Bedrooms 1,441 Sq Ft $2,260 / mo
Top Budget-Friendly Neighborhoods in Vancouver
(For 1 bedroom apartments)- Neighborhoods Average Sq Ft Average Rent
- Starcrest 719 Sq Ft $1,311/mo
- Harney Heights 652 Sq Ft $1,318/mo
- Northeast Hazel Dell-Starcrest 730 Sq Ft $1,337/mo
- West Minnehaha 646 Sq Ft $1,378/mo
- Bagley Downs 626 Sq Ft $1,406/mo
- North Image 766 Sq Ft $1,409/mo
- Landover-Sharmel 711 Sq Ft $1,483/mo
- Image 710 Sq Ft $1,488/mo
- Northeast Hazel Dell 683 Sq Ft $1,492/mo
- Ogden 714 Sq Ft $1,492/mo
